1. Rank Math SEO – Best SEO Plugin
Rank Math has become the leading SEO plugin for WordPress. It offers more features in its free version than competitors do in premium versions, including schema markup, redirect management, and advanced SEO analysis.
Why It’s Essential:
- On-page SEO optimization
- Schema markup generator
- Keyword rank tracking
- Built-in redirect manager
- Google Search Console integration
- AI-powered content suggestions
2. BlogVault – Security and Backup
BlogVault combines security and backup in one essential plugin. Protect your site from hackers while ensuring you can always recover from any disaster.
Why It’s Essential:
- Real-time malware scanning
- Automated daily backups
- One-click site restore
- Firewall protection
- Staging environment

4. FluentCRM – Email Marketing
FluentCRM is a self-hosted email marketing solution that keeps your data on your server. Build email lists, create automations, and track campaigns without monthly fees.
Why It’s Essential:
- No monthly email fees
- Marketing automation
- Contact segmentation
- Email sequence builder
- WooCommerce integration
5. CleanTalk – Anti-Spam Protection
CleanTalk protects your site from spam without annoying CAPTCHAs. It works invisibly to block spam comments, registrations, and form submissions.
6. Smash Balloon – Social Media Feeds
Smash Balloon displays your social media content beautifully on your WordPress site. Show feeds from Instagram, Facebook, Twitter, and YouTube.
7. SearchWP – Enhanced Site Search
SearchWP improves WordPress’s default search functionality dramatically. It searches custom fields, PDFs, and provides relevant results that actually help visitors find content.
